Seasonal Playbook
Spring brings vigorous growth that responds from form pruning and fungus inspections. Peak heat in Longview, WA can strain canopies; hydration plans and light balancing keep roots protected. Fall is ideal for clearance cuts, bracing checks, and storm readiness. Winter allows major structural work with reduced sap flow and clear sightlines.
By timing work with seasonal cycles, we reduce stress on trees, accelerate healing, and secure long-lasting results.

Service Depth
Shaping is more than cutting limbs. We design balanced branch structure, edit weight over roofs, and coach young trees for future health. Tree removal are planned step by step: rigging, lifts, cranes, or manual dismantles depending on space. Stumps are erased with accuracy to reclaim your soil.
Soil care addresses compaction. Air spading opens pathways, subsurface feeding delivers balanced nutrients, and organic cover stabilizes moisture. Disease monitoring catches issues early, preserving canopy health.
